Logan is a somewhat small city located in the state of Ohio. With a population of 7,142 people and four associated neighborhoods, Logan is the 213th largest community in Ohio.
The percentage of adults in Logan with college degrees is slightly lower than the national average of 21.84% for all communities. 14.33% of adults in Logan have a bachelor's degree or advanced degree.
The per capita income in Logan in 2022 was $29,193, which is lower middle income relative to Ohio and the nation. This equates to an annual income of $116,772 for a family of four. However, Logan contains both very wealthy and poor people as well.
The people who call Logan home describe themselves as belonging to a variety of racial and ethnic groups. The greatest number of Logan residents report their race to be White, followed by Asian. Important ancestries of people in Logan include German, English, Irish, Welsh, and Scottish.
The most common language spoken in Logan is English. Other important languages spoken here include Italian and Polish.
